Rotate the bezel until the … WebAzimuths are defined as horizontal angles that are measured from the reference meridian in the clockwise direction. Azimuths are also called a whole circle bearing system (W.C.B). Azimuths are used in compass surveying, plane surveying, where it is generally measured from the north. But azimuths are measured from the south by astronomers and in ...

In navigation, bearing or azimuth is the horizontal angle between the direction of an object and north or another object. The angle value can be specified in various angular units, such as degrees, mils, or grad.
